Ex-Celtic player Charlie Nicholas believes Ange Postecoglou could drop both Tom Rogic and Reo Hatate for this weekend’s game against Rangers.

The Gers managed to disrupt the midfield during the Scottish Cup semi-final a couple of weeks ago, and Nicholas thinks Postecoglou will be looking to change his personnel in that area of the pitch on Sunday:

“Ange will be tinkering. Rangers upset his players’ rhythm at Hampden. Tom Rogic or Reo Hatate might not start. I do think the manager will change his midfield and for that reason,” they will win it.”

Hatate has looked fatigued in recent weeks, while Rogic was benched for the 2-0 win against Ross County, so Nicholas could be on to something in terms of the team selection.

Matt O’Riley may well be favoured ahead of the Australian international once again when they take on their Glasgow rivals, while David Turnbull would likely be the player to replace Hatate.

Nicholas says that he will be backing Postecoglou’s team to win the match if the changes are made, but we shall see how the match transpires. Even a draw would put the Hoops in excellent shape to reclaim the title.
